The Committee's statutory purpose is "to plan, oversee and coordinate the delivery of criminal and certain noncriminal legal services by all salaried public counsel, bar advocate and other assigned counsel programs, and private attorneys serving on a per case basis."  G. L. c. 211D, § 1.

The Committee appoints or assigns counsel for indigent or marginally indigent persons in all Massachusetts state court proceedings in which the availability of legal representation is required by a constitutional provision, a statute or a rule of the Supreme Judicial Court.

The Committee is also responsible for the preparation of budget estimates and for the efficient management of state appropriations and other funds received by the Committee, consistent with the statutory mandate to provide effective legal representation for indigent persons.

Committee members serve for a term of three years and are generally subject to G. L. c. 268A, the Conflict of Interest law.  See G. L. c. 211D, § 1.
